Questions · FAQ
Frequently asked questions about the HTC One Max.
What are the features of the HTC One Max?
These are the main features and specifications of the HTC One Max:
- Screen: 5.9" LCD IPS
- Resolution: 1080 x 1920 px · FHD
- RAM: 2GB
- Storage: 16GB
- Processor: Qualcomm Snapdragon 600 APQ8064T
What is the price of HTC One Max?
There are no prices available for the HTC One Max in United States.
How long does the battery of the HTC One Max last?
The HTC One Max battery has a capacity of 3300 mAh.
When was the HTC One Max release date?
The HTC One Max was unveiled on Tuesday, October 1, 2013.
Which camera does the HTC One Max have?
The HTC One Max has a rear camera and its main sensor is STMicroelectronics VD6869 with a resolution of 4Mpx.
